Top Searches for this datasheetCharger Protection with Internal BD6040GUL BD6040GUL charger protection developed portable devices provides over voltage protection charger ICs. Built-in circuits include overvoltage lockout, overcurrent limit, undervoltage protection, internal start delay, status flag.
